Types of Addiction Treatment Available

In Bedford, addiction treatment facilities offer a range of programs tailored to individual needs and severity of addiction. Understanding these options helps patients make informed decisions about their recovery journey.

Detoxification (Detox)

Detox is often the first step in recovery, providing medical supervision as the body clears itself of addictive substances. Given the risks associated with withdrawal, especially from opioids and alcohol, a safe detox environment is critical.

Inpatient Rehabilitation

Inpatient or residential rehab programs offer intensive care and round-the-clock support. Patients live at the facility during treatment, engaging in structured therapy, medical care, and peer support.

Outpatient Programs

Outpatient treatment allows individuals to maintain daily responsibilities while attending therapy sessions and support meetings. This option can be appropriate for those with mild to moderate addictions or following inpatient care.

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T)

MAT combines FDA-approved medications with counseling to treat opioid use disorder and alcohol dependence effectively. Common medications include methadone, buprenorphine, and naltrexone.

Support Services and Aftercare in Bedford

Recovery doesn’t end after initial treatment; ongoing support is crucial to prevent relapse and maintain sobriety. Bedford offers various support services including:

  • Twelve-Step Programs: Groups like Alcoholics Anonymous (AA) and Narcotics Anonymous (NA) provide peer support.
  • Counseling and Therapy: Continued individual or group counseling helps address underlying issues.
  • Sober Living Homes: Transitional housing provides a supportive environment post-rehab.
  • Community Resources: Local support networks offer educational workshops and family assistance.

Choosing the Right Treatment Center

Selecting the appropriate addiction treatment center in Bedford requires careful consideration of several factors to ensure the best chance of sustainable recovery:

Accreditation and Licensing

Verify that the treatment center is licensed by state authorities and accredited by reputable organizations like The Joint Commission or CARF. Accreditation indicates that the facility meets high standards of care.

Customized Treatment Plans

A quality center will offer personalized treatment plans designed around each patient’s specific addiction, health status, and personal goals.

Qualified Staff

Look for centers staffed by certified addiction specialists, licensed therapists, medical doctors, and support personnel trained in evidence-based practices.

Aftercare and Relapse Prevention

Strong aftercare support is essential to maintain long-term sobriety, so inquire about the center’s commitment to relapse prevention, alumni programs, and ongoing counseling.

Insurance and Cost Considerations

Many addiction treatment programs in Bedford accept various insurance plans including Medicaid, Medicare, and private insurance, which can significantly reduce out-of-pocket expenses. Facilities may also offer sliding scale fees or payment plans. It is advisable to confirm coverage details and explore financial assistance options before admission.

Frequently Asked Questions About Addiction Treatment in Bedford, PA

1. How long does addiction treatment typically last?

Treatment lengths vary depending on the severity of addiction and the program type but generally range from 30 days to 90 days or more. Some may require ongoing outpatient care or support.

2. Is detox necessary before starting treatment?

For many substances, especially alcohol and opioids, detox is a recommended first step to manage withdrawal safely before beginning behavioral therapy or counseling.

3. What if I don’t have insurance to cover treatment?

Many centers offer sliding scale fees, payment plans, or connect patients with Medicaid or other assistance programs to help cover costs.

4. Can family members be involved in the treatment process?

Yes, family therapy is often an integral part of treatment to repair relationships and build a strong support system.

5. What makes medication-assisted treatment effective?

MAT combines medications with counseling to reduce cravings and withdrawal symptoms, improving the likelihood of long-term recovery.
